Ryan had his first professional fight in 1887 and was undefeated in 31 matches when he faced Mysterious Billy Smith for the world welterweight championship on July 26, 1894, in Minneapolis. Ryan won the title with a 20-round decision.
He claimed the middleweight title when Bob Fitzsimmons vacated it in 1895, but his claim wasn't generally recognized until his 10-round decision over George Green on February 25, 1898, in San Francisco. He then relinquished his welterweight championship to fight as a middleweight.
Ryan retained the title even during a two-year retirement in 1905 and 1906. He returned to the ring for two fights in 1907. His final appearance was an exhibition against Battling Nelson on August 4, 1907.
A clever fighter with a very good left jab, Ryan was often called on as an instructor. He won 85 matches, 68 by knockout; lost 3, 1 by knockout and 1 on a foul; and fought 5 draws, 9 no-decisions, and 6 no-contests.
